pronate

/ˈpɹəʊ.neɪt/

Meanings
  • Verb

    Turn or cause to turn so that a part is facing downwards or in a lower position.

    - "He pronates his hand to check the pulse."
    - "The doctor asked the patient to pronate his feet."
